BIOS启动模块和系统主板技术方案

技术编号:14065590 阅读:38 留言:0更新日期:2016-11-28 11:22
本实用新型专利技术公开了一种BIOS启动模块和系统主板。其中,该BIOS启动模块包括:存储器,存储器用于存储多种类型的设备的配置信息,配置信息为启动设备所需的信息;BIOS芯片,分别与指定接口和存储器连接,用于从存储器中读取与外部设备的设备类型参数对应的配置信息,以启动外部设备,指定接口用于接入外部设备。本实用新型专利技术解决了相关技术中BIOS的兼容性较差的技术问题。

【技术实现步骤摘要】

本技术涉及计算机设备领域,具体而言,涉及一种BIOS启动模块和系统主板
技术介绍
PCI-Express是最新的总线和接口标准,它原来的名称为“3GIO”,是由英特尔在2001年提出的,它代表着下一代I/O接口标准。PCIE采用高速串行点对点的双通道高带宽传输方式,可为连接的设备分配独享的通道带宽,而不共享总线带宽,该接口支持主动电源管理,错误报告,端对端的可靠性传输,热插拔以及服务质量(QOS)等功能。为了满足客户的不同需求,PCI Express也有多种规格,从PCI Express 1X到PCI Express 16X,能满足将来各类低速设备和高速设备的需求。PCI-Express最新的接口是PCIE 3.0接口,其比特率为8GB/s,约为上一代产品带宽的两倍,并且可以实现发射器和接收器均衡、PLL改善以及时钟数据恢复等一系列重要的新功能,以改善数据传输和数据保护的性能。在搭配不同的PCIE设备时,系统中BIOS需要改变系统启动的配置,以完成对不同PCIE设备的识别与使用,对于常见的BIOS,其往往只能兼容几种常见的PCIE外接设备,对于新增加的PCIE外设,如果BIOS中没有存储相关的配置信息,则不能实现对其的识别,也即现有的BIOS的兼容较差,在搭配不同的外设时,需要重新订制BIOS,而重新订制BIOS的成本往往较高。针对相关技术中BIOS的兼容性较差的技术问题,目前尚未提出有效的解决方案。
技术实现思路
本技术实施例提供了一种BIOS启动模块和系统主板,以至少解决相关技术中BIOS的兼容性较差的技术问题。根据本技术实施例的一个方面,提供了一种BIOS启动模块,该模块包括:存储器,存储器用于存储多种类型的设备的配置信息,其中,配置信息为启动设备所需的信息;BIOS芯片,分别与指定接口和存储器连接,用于从存储器中读取与外部设备的设备类型参数对应的配置信息,以启动外部设备,其中,指定接口用于接入外部设备。进一步地,启动模块包括:中继器,分别与BIOS芯片和指定接口连接,用于增强在BIOS芯片与指定接口之间传输的信号的强度。进一步地,存储器为EEPROM存储器。进一步地,存储器通过I2C总线与BIOS芯片连接。进一步地,指定接口包括PCIE接口,PCIE接口的数量为至少两个。进一步地,外部设备为支持PCIE接口的设备,外部设备包括:网卡、存储设备、加速卡、隔离卡、加密卡以及显卡。进一步地,外部设备上设置有EEPROM存储器,EEPROM存储器用于保存外部设备的设备类型参数。进一步地,配置信息包括系统启动的配置信息和驱动信息。进一步地,启动模块还包括:信息写入模块,与存储器连接,用于在存储器中不存在与外部设备对应的配置信息时,写入与外部设备对应的配置信息至存储器。根据本技术实施例的另一个方面,提供了一种系统主板,该系统主板包括:上述的任意一种BIOS启动模块。在本技术实施例中,在存储器中存储多种类型的设备的配置信息,配置信息为启动设备所需的信息;BIOS芯片,分别与指定接口和存储器连接,在指定接口接入外部设备时,读取外部设备的设备类型参数,并从存储器中读取与设备类型参数对应的配置信息,以实现对启动该外部设备时所需的相关配置的配置,由于在外部设备发生更新时,能对存储器中对应的配置信息进行更新,从而解决了相关技术中BIOS的兼容性较差的技术问题,实现了提高BIOS的兼容性的技术效果。附图说明此处所说明的附图用来提供对本技术的进一步理解,构成本申请的一部分,本技术的示意性实施例及其说明用于解释本技术,并不构成对本技术的不当限定。在附图中:图1是根据本技术实施例的BIOS启动模块的示意图;以及图2是根据本技术实施例的一个可选的BIOS启动模块的示意图。具体实施方式为了使本
的人员更好地理解本技术方案,下面将结合本技术实施例中的附图,对本技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本技术一部分的实施例,而不是全部的实施例。基于本技术中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都应当属于本技术保护的范围。需要说明的是,本技术的说明书和权利要求书及上述附图中的术语“第一”、“第二”等是用于区别类似的对象,而不必用于描述特定的顺序或先后次序。应该理解这样使用的数据在适当情况下可以互换。此外,术语“包括”和“具有”以及他们的任何变形,意图在于覆盖不排他的包含,例如,包含了一系列电子元件或电气元件的系统、产品或设备不必限于清楚地列出的那些电子元件或电气元件,而是可包括没有清楚地列出的或对于这些系统、产品或设备固有的其它电子元件或电气元件。首先,在对本技术实施例进行描述的过程中出现的部分名词或术语适用于如下解释:BIOS:BIOS是英文\Basic Input Output System\的缩略词,中文名称就是\基本输入输出系统\。它保存着计算机最重要的基本输入输出的程序、开机后自检程序和系统自启动程序,它可从CMOS中读写系统设置的具体信息。其主要功能是为计算机提供最底层的、最直接的硬件设置和控制。EEPROM:Electrically Erasable Programmable Read-Only Memory,电可擦可编程只读存储器,一种掉电后数据不丢失的存储芯片,EEPROM可以在电脑上或专用设备上擦除已有信息,重新编程。根据本技术实施例,提供了一种BIOS启动模块的实施例,图1是根据本技术实施例的BIOS启动模块的示意图,如图1所示,该模块包括:存储器10和BIOS芯片30。存储器10,存储器用于存储多种类型的设备的配置信息,配置信息为启动设备所需的信息。BIOS芯片30,分别与指定接口和存储器连接,用于从存储器中读取与外部设备的设备类型参数对应的配置信息,以启动外部设备,指定接口用于接入外部设备。通过上述实施例,在存储器中存储多种类型的设备的配置信息,配置信息为启动设备所需的信息;BIOS芯片,分别与指定接口和存储器连接,在指定接口接入外部设备时,读取外部设备的设备类型参数,并从存储器中读取与设备类型参数对应的配置信息,以实现对启动该外部设备时所需的相关配置的配置,由于在外部设备发生更新时,能对存储器中对应的配置信息进行更新,从而解决了相关技术中BIOS的兼容性较差的技术问题,实现了提高BIOS的兼容性的技术效果。上述的配置信息包括系统启动的配置信息和驱动信息;上述的存储器为EEPROM存储器,存储器通过I2C总线与BIOS芯片连接,使用EEPROM作为增强外接设备兼容性的介质,改变了传统方案中通过更改BIOS配置以便增强外接设备的兼容性的方式,EEPROM作为只读存储器充分发挥了掉电后数据不丢失的特性,便于数据的保存。进而,可以在PCIE设备的EEPROM中刷入大量PCIE外设的信息,如driving table(即驱动表)等信息,满足了同一个硬件平台对不同PCIE外设的兼容性,使系统的使用效率大大提升,同时,在出现新的外设PCIE设备时,只需在相应的EEPROM中刷写入与系统相关的配置及驱动信息即可,系统就可以对PCIE外设进行识别与本文档来自技高网
...
BIOS启动模块和系统主板

【技术保护点】
一种BIOS启动模块,其特征在于,包括:存储器,所述存储器用于存储多种类型的设备的配置信息,其中,所述配置信息为启动设备所需的信息;BIOS芯片,分别与指定接口和所述存储器连接,用于从所述存储器中读取与外部设备的设备类型参数对应的所述配置信息,以启动所述外部设备,其中,所述指定接口用于接入所述外部设备。

【技术特征摘要】
1.一种BIOS启动模块,其特征在于,包括:存储器,所述存储器用于存储多种类型的设备的配置信息,其中,所述配置信息为启动设备所需的信息;BIOS芯片,分别与指定接口和所述存储器连接,用于从所述存储器中读取与外部设备的设备类型参数对应的所述配置信息,以启动所述外部设备,其中,所述指定接口用于接入所述外部设备。2.根据权利要求1所述的启动模块,其特征在于,所述启动模块包括:中继器,分别与所述BIOS芯片和所述指定接口连接,用于增强在所述BIOS芯片与所述指定接口之间传输的信号的强度。3.根据权利要求1或2所述的启动模块,其特征在于,所述存储器为EEPROM存储器。4.根据权利要求1或2所述的启动模块,其特征在于,所述存储器通过I2C总线与所述BIOS芯片连接。5.根据权利要求1或2所述的启动模块,其特征在于,所述指定接口包括PCI...

【专利技术属性】
技术研发人员:张帅王丹
申请(专利权)人:北京立华莱康平台科技有限公司
类型:新型
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1